   Richard I found a bad link on the auction deluxe 4.00 version.
If you click on
"veiw closed auctions"
then click any old auction to view then click on
"Send To Friend: (mail this auction to a friend)"

It will take you back tot the start page. Just to make sure, I checked your demo on your site and it does the same .. Any quick fixes for this?

   I found this also, and just removed the portion of the script that displays this line and link from the closed item page. I mean, why would you want to send a copy of the closed link to a freind anyway?

I think it is a dead link becouse the script in this line refers the script to the old auction item dat file located in the open auction category directories, which it doesnt find when you click on it, becouse, well, it is now in the closed item directory. The script then just defaults to auction.pl display becouse it cannot complete the process.
